Armand Marseille was a Russian of French Huguenot ancestry, who took up residence in Köppelsdorf, Germany where he built a highly successful doll business. His story began in St Petersburg in Russia where he was born in 1856. His father was educated at the Imperial School of Art in St. Petersburg and worked as an architect. The Marseille family moved within the social circle of the court of the Russian Czar. Armand was well educated, spoke multiple languages, had a strong work ethic, and a sound understanding of the business world.
